I hunt north eastern Missouri close to the Iowa line. It my expierence and I have been told by people that live there you really go to getting in the bigger deer after you cross the Missouri river which is just north of there. The farther north in Missouri you go the better. In not saying there aren't good bucks there in that area but I wouldn't expect anything outrageous.

I hunt in Hickory County. Crosstimbers to be exact. Bout 65miles N of springfield. Its a family friend ranch/farm, they run a intensive grazing program and hate deer so I have the run of the place. Its 2000ac but I hold up in a block of 40ac that he never touches cuz its so steep and has deep coolies and cuts. The ridges are beautiful and full of hard timber. I absolutely love MO and if I could make a living there I would buy some land in that county. BTW- The ranch backs up to the lucas oil family farm which is huge. Lots of pressure on opening days, I hear gun shots everywhere. A lot of locals do deer drives or pushes. That normally puts the deer hiding and scatters them out good. Ive been able to harvest several doe and shot a 8pt (120class) on my last day in 2010 and the neighbor found a 8pt dead several days after so he saved the horns for me. I bleached them in 2011 and hung them up If you know someone in the area they are welcome but if your an outsider not so much. I really like the area and the way they live. Its a country boy life out there and most families are Mennonites.

Used to hunt in Gasconade County (directly west of Franklin) until my FIL moved to the Veterans Home. Lots of wooded areas. Deer for the most part had larger bodies with small antlers. Not saying there are not good antlers in the area. I know that Franklin County was one of the top producers for the last several years (numbers wise). Here is a link to county by county harvest numbers for the last several years : http://mdc.mo.gov/hunting-trapping/hunting-outlooks-and-reports/deer-reports/deer-harvest-summaries
